The QI-300-V-485 from Qeed is a versatile AC and DC ModBus current transformer featuring Modbus RS485 and 0-10 Vdc outputs. This device offers selectable current ranges of 0 to 150 Amps and 0 to 300 Amps, powered by a 12 to 30 Vdc power supply. It ensures safety and reliability with an isolation of up to 3000V between input and output.
The QI-300-V-485 accurately measures AC True RMS and DC currents with bipolar directionality. It can display key metrics such as Maximum Current Value, Minimum Current Value, and Amps Used on its registers. The RMS current values are available as a signed 16-bit integer, a 32-bit floating-point number, and a swapped 32-bit floating-point number. Additionally, Amp-hours Min/Max values can be reset.
The transformer is user-configurable with DIP switches or free software available on our website, allowing adjustments to Baud rate, address, measuring range, and AC/DC settings. It supports easy installation on DIN rail or with screws.
This QI-300-V-485 is particularly valuable for solar panel applications and battery charging networks because of its bipolar current measurement capability.

Monopolar Measurement
Modbus Current Transformer with monopolar output
Normal output response. Input 0-300 Amps output 0-10 V or reading in Modbus RTU Registers
Bipolar Measurement
Modbus Current Transformer with bipolar output
Modbus or Voltage output response for the bipolar setting. -300 Amp to +300 Amps 0-10 V with the 5 V being 0 Amps or with Modbus RTU the output will be a signed 16 bit integer.

DIP Switch Settings

To use the EEPROM settings with the software and a PC, set the DIP switches to off. Otherwise, use the DIP settings to suit your applications. The EEPROM settings offer more options, such as setting the address from 1 to 250 and adjusting the Baud rate up to 115200.
If you want to set up the current maximum range or the bipolar output to 0-10V without using the EEPROM, set the address to 0001.
All changes to the DIP switch settings must be followed by a power reset; otherwise, the changes will not take effect.
